Output d51d654522464bc26325d08fbd28de8f02984cc81f45bb4e9bb1722f8f9b1433:20

value
52534520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 678e5171ebef4cb0bf7b24061518ee90db3f2500 OP_EQUAL
address
MHLiKdJgErcRta8HH3ensDBJyr63K2ETZC
transaction
d51d654522464bc26325d08fbd28de8f02984cc81f45bb4e9bb1722f8f9b1433
spent
true